Output 50faafcb44db2bec4996176aa9f3cbcbd8dca096012340a2c0510002c8daec8f:0

value
24552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18538936c2a2699f2411aed6dc25419e2bb46050 OP_EQUALVERIFY OP_CHECKSIG
address
13DdHncSMKQKhcm3mE3cwthv5TVPwSk7Ka
transaction
50faafcb44db2bec4996176aa9f3cbcbd8dca096012340a2c0510002c8daec8f
spent
true